powered by simpleCommunicator - 2.0.59     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Сравнение СУБД [игнор отключен] [закрыт для гостей] /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
15 сообщений из 315, страница 13 из 13
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33314592
gardenman
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Gluk (Kazan) gardenmanЗачем человеку нужно отслеживать баланс каждые пять минут? ну?....
И это нужно разве что - главбуху.. да и то на момент закрытия квартала, когда делают заключительные обороты. Да и то, заключительные обороты делают в прошедшим днём.

Человеку оно канешна може и не нужно, а вот биллинговой системе
Тому-же RADIUS-у скажем

Может знаток биллинга и RADIUS товарищ Gluk (Kazan) расскажет зачем радиусу нужено собирать по нескольким таблицам черти-что чтобы вытащить некий остаток, который будет консистентным на момент запроса, но не на момент выдачи разрешения радиусом пользователю разрешения на вход? И, почему как правило в биллинге (в простых системах) используется чаще всего MySQL (Даже не постгрес)? Кто в подобных системах следит за тем, чтобы юзер не законнектился дважды в одно и то же время (хотя системы и тарификация всякая бывает)? Каким образом и кто следит за сессией, кто ее отключает, когда лимит средств исчерпан? Если товарищ Глюк ответит себе на эти вопросы, то он поймет наконец что версионник в данном случае нахрен не нужен.
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33314608
Фотография Gluk (Kazan)
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Уважаемый, если Вам от меня чего-то надо постарайтесь сформулировать это по человечьи и без сарказма. В противном случае, я буду считать, что Ваши вопли адресованы в пустоту. Иными словами Вы работаете на публику.
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33314623
SkyNet77
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
авторчто версионник в данном случае нахрен не нужен.
А зачем такую бесполезную штуку МС пытается рализовать? Да еще и гордится этим?
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33314654
ggv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
ggv
Гость
SkyNet77А зачем такую бесполезную штуку МС пытается рализовать? Да еще и гордится этим?
Речь не о том, что это бесполезная штука, imho.
Просто это два разных подхода к разрешению конфликтов - ранний (блокировочник), и поздний (версионник)
Что лучше, каждый решает для себя сам.
MS, imho, нашла способ воплотить алгоритм позднего разрешения конфликтов каким-то более эффективным способом, чем существующие. Поэтому и создает его.
Что получится - будем посмотреть.
Скорее всего, изыскания в этом направлении ведут все вендоры.
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33314655
gardenman
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SkyNet77 авторчто версионник в данном случае нахрен не нужен.
А зачем такую бесполезную штуку МС пытается рализовать? Да еще и гордится этим?
А как вы думаете почему IBM и не собирается это реализовывать?
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33315094
ggv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
ggv
Гость
рискну предположить, что пока механизм раннего разрешения конфликтов позволяет наращивать производительность системы, не возникает потребности в механизме позднего разрешения.
можно на попытки ms посмотреть и под таким углом зрения.
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33315383
ggv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
ggv
Гость
можно сказать и по-другому:
неважно, что одни транзакции могут ожидать завершения других странзакций, неважно до тех пор, пока время выполнения workload укладывается в бизнес требования (или меньше чем у конкурентов)

Или совсем уже по-другому (но не корректно, так как для выполнения одной и той же бизнес задачи может потребоваться разный набор разных транзакций на разных системах):
неважно, что транзакция X может ожидать завершения транзакции Y, если общее время выполнения двух транзакций устраивает, (или меньше чем у ....)
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33315391
DimaR
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ggv SkyNet77А зачем такую бесполезную штуку МС пытается рализовать? Да еще и гордится этим?
Речь не о том, что это бесполезная штука, imho.
Просто это два разных подхода к разрешению конфликтов - ранний (блокировочник), и поздний (версионник)
Что лучше, каждый решает для себя сам.
MS, imho, нашла способ воплотить алгоритм позднего разрешения конфликтов каким-то более эффективным способом, чем существующие. Поэтому и создает его.
Что получится - будем посмотреть.
Скорее всего, изыскания в этом направлении ведут все вендоры.

рискну предположить, что пока механизм раннего разрешения конфликтов позволяет наращивать производительность системы, не возникает потребности в механизме позднего разрешения.
можно на попытки ms посмотреть и под таким углом зрения.


Причем тут это?
Никто не мешает в оракле использовать пессимистическое блокирование (если я правильно понял).

(повторюсь еще 25 раз)
Но при этом в оракле нет необходимости в эскалации блокировок,
и читатели не блокируют писателей,
и писатели не блокируют читателей.
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33315410
ggv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
ggv
Гость
DimaR - я всего лишь попытался предположить, зачем MS создает версионность.
Вот и все.
Ну и опять же:
если экскалация блокировок;
блокирование писателей читателями;
блокирование читателей писателями,
позволяет выполнить задачу за устраивающее бизнес условия время, или быстрее чем у конкурентов, то проблемы нет.
Возможно (опять мое предположение) что у MS появились проблемы, и она пытается их решить созданием версионности (механизма позднего обнаружения конфиликтов)

Кстати, экскалация блокировок иногда выгодно добиваться конфигурационными настройками, если это увеличивает общую производительность на конкретной задачи. Но это к вопросу "зачем MS создает версионность" не относится.
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33315462
DimaR
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ggv
позволяет выполнить задачу за устраивающее бизнес условия время, или быстрее чем у конкурентов, то проблемы нет.
Возможно (опять мое предположение) что у MS появились проблемы, и она пытается их решить созданием версионности (механизма позднего обнаружения конфиликтов)

Мы общаемся на флеймовом форуме во флеймовом топике, и фраза
- "нас устраивает и нам другого не надо"
является оффтопом
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33315525
ggv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
ggv
Гость
DimaR - да неет, смысл был другой, смысл был в том, что пока в формальных тестах (то, что можног посмотреть), блокировочники чувтсвуют себя неплохо. Некоторые даже получше версионников.
Так в угоду чему отказыватся от достигнутой производительности?
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33315555
gardenman
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ggvDimaR - да неет, смысл был другой, смысл был в том, что пока в формальных тестах (то, что можног посмотреть), блокировочники чувтсвуют себя неплохо. Некоторые даже получше версионников.
Так в угоду чему отказыватся от достигнутой производительности?
Ответ: чтоб читатели не блокировали писателей. А то это такое унижение - быть заблокированным...
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33315712
A. S.
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Yo!!
http://oraclemind.blogspot.com/2005/04/oracle-vs-mssql2k.html


Yo!!
также существует 3 типа partitioned indexes:
- local index, т.е. индекс на партицию.
- global partitioned index, такой индкс разбивается на секции по другим правилам нежели сама таблица.
- global non-partitioned index, такой индекс не разбивается на секции хотя таблица разбита.
- всевозможные комбинации из этих 3-х


всевозможные комбинации из этих 3-х это как?
1. Локально-глобальный partitioned index
2. Локально-глобальный non-partitioned index
3. Глобально-локальный partitioned index
4. Глобально-локальный non-partitioned index
5. Глобально-глобальный partitioned-non-partitioned index

Бреддд. Сюда можно еще и префиксность локальных индексов прокомбиницировать :)
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33316061
Yo!!
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
2A. S.
OK, подправлю, было лениво дословно переводить этот текст. не думал что вызовет такие вопросы .. но раз вызывает обязательно исправлю :)

Oracle also provides three types of partitioned indexes:
• A local index is an index on a partitioned table that is partitioned using the exact same partition strategy as the underlying partitioned table. Each partition of a local index corresponds to one and only one partition of the underlying table.
• A global partitioned index is an index on a partitioned or non-partitioned table that is partitioned using a different partitioning-key from the table.
• A global non-partitioned index is essentially identical to an index on a non-partitioned table. The index structure is not partitioned.
Oracle allows all possible combinations of partitioned and non-partitioned indexes and tables: a partitioned table can have partitioned and non-partitioned indexes, and a non-partitioned table can have partitioned and non-partitioned indexes.
...
Рейтинг: 0 / 0
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
    #33316753
A. S.
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Yo!!2A. S.
OK, подправлю, было лениво дословно переводить этот текст. не думал что вызовет такие вопросы .. но раз вызывает обязательно исправлю :)


Было б неплохо. А то понимаешь ли вводите людей в заблуждение. :)

Yo!!
Oracle also provides three types of partitioned indexes:
• A local index is an index on a partitioned table that is partitioned using the exact same partition strategy as the underlying partitioned table. Each partition of a local index corresponds to one and only one partition of the underlying table.
• A global partitioned index is an index on a partitioned or non-partitioned table that is partitioned using a different partitioning-key from the table.
• A global non-partitioned index is essentially identical to an index on a non-partitioned table. The index structure is not partitioned.
Oracle allows all possible combinations of partitioned and non-partitioned indexes and tables: a partitioned table can have partitioned and non-partitioned indexes, and a non-partitioned table can have partitioned and non-partitioned indexes.
...
Рейтинг: 0 / 0
15 сообщений из 315, страница 13 из 13
Форумы / Сравнение СУБД [игнор отключен] [закрыт для гостей] /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]